What is the past tense of slip away from?

What's the past tense of slip away from? Here's the word you're looking for.

Answer

The past tense of slip away from is slipped away from.

The third-person singular simple present indicative form of slip away from is slips away from.

The present participle of slip away from is slipping away from.

The past participle of slip away from is slipped away from.
